Marketing Automation Consultant vs In-House Team – What’s Better for Your Business?

Marketing Automation Consultant
July 15, 2025

Businesses are always looking for new and smarter ways to attract customers. Marketing automation is the best solution to this problem, it is a system that streamlines repetitive marketing tasks like social media posts, lead nurturing, email campaigns, and many more.

As companies know more about the values of automation, a simple question arises like Should we hire a marketing automation consultant or build an in-house team? If we are looking for the answer it totally depends on your resources, goals, and long-term strategies.

In this article, we will break down both options to help companies to make the right decision for their business success.

What Is a Marketing Automation Consultant?

A marketing automation consultant is an external expert who helps businesses in their plans, implementation, and to optimize their marketing automation strategies. They are experienced in using every popular tool like Marketo, Mailchimp, HubSpot, Salesforce Marketing Cloud, or ActiveCampaign.

Their role is to:

  • Analyze and mark your current marketing processes
  • Choosing tools or strategies according to your goals 
  • Create automated workflows (CRM syncing, lead scoring, emails)
  • Training In-house team or manage campaigns on your behalf

Consultants also offer to work on contract base or per project base according to your facility. You don’t need to pay the cost of hiring a full-time employee if you hire a marketing consultant.

What Does an In-House Marketing Automation Team Look Like?

If we are talking about the In-house marketing automation team then we talk about the full-time employees who manage the automation tools and campaigns regularly.

The team depends on your business size, might include:

  • Marketing Automation Specialist manage tools and builds workflows
  • CRM Manager ensures that the customers data is clean and connected
  • Content or Email Marketer creates content for automation process
  • Analytics Expert tracks campaign performance and optimized it accordingly

In-house team means companies own team who can fit with business culture, allowing for long-term alignment and strategy development.

Pros and Cons of Hiring a Marketing Automation Consultant

Pros and Cons

There are a lot of advantages and disadvantages of hiring a marketing automation consultant, some of them are listed below:

Pros:

  • Expertise: Consultants bring a bundle of experience across multiple niches and platforms.
  • Quicker Implementation: They are quick in their work like finding the problems and launch campaigns accordingly.
  • Less cost: You don’t need to pay full-time salaries 
  • Objective perspective: They offer an outsider’s point of view, often spot technical issues that you may miss.

Cons:

  • Limited Time: They might be handling multiple clients at once and not available all the time for your answers.
  • Short-term engagement: They may not fully align with long-term business goals.
  • Decision control: Decision might take longer because the consultants are not part of your team.

Pros and Cons of Building an In-House Team

The pros and cons of building an In-house team are listed below:

Pros:

  • Full authority:  Manage all of your marketing automation process under your nose
  • Long-term strategies: Build strategies according to your brand because team knows brand very well 
  • Communication: Communicate easily with each other or with departments
  • Consistent Growth: In-house team benefits in scaling your brand and consistent automation

Cons:

  • High Cost: Employees salaries, training, and benefits can be expensive 
  • Face Hiring Challenges: High skilled experts can be hard to find
  • Slower setup: It’s hard to train a team, time taking process
  • Limited knowledge: Team may have less knowledge or experience using different tools   

Cost Comparison: Consultant vs. In-House team

When choosing between an In-house marketing team or a consultant, the decision often comes down to cost and time to achieve your targets. Let’s explore the cost estimation of both options:

Cost to hire a Consultant:

  • Charges between $70-$200 per hour or project based fees
  • Best for niche specific campaigns
  • You don’t need to pay full-time charges or for benefits 

In-House team Costs:

  • Full-time employee have salaries around $4000 to $10000 per month
  • You have to buy tools for employees that comes in additional charges 
  • It is best for long-term projects, large-scale operations

In my opinion, hiring a marketing automation consultant is more affordable in the short term project. On the other hand, if you’re handling a long-term project focused on consistent growth, it is better to build an In-house marketing team that can handle the process under your supervision.

When Should You Choose a Consultant?

How to Choose

Hiring a consultant is a clever decision when you focus on quick results, such as launching a product or starting a marketing campaign. When you hire a marketing consultant, you are not only hiring an external help, you also hire in-depth expertise that will benefit you quickly or save you the cost of hiring a full time employee.

If you are new to marketing automation, a marketing consultant can benefit you in many ways like help you to understand the set-up workflow, tools, and avoid common mistakes.

Hiring a marketing automation consultant is very helpful for small businesses with limited resources or budget, as you only have to pay for the services you need.

When Is an In-House Team the Better Option?

If your company is growing fastly and requires continuous marketing automation then building an In-house team is a better choice. In-house teams can dedicatedly handle a large volume of campaigns and data because they know deeply about the brand.

Having a full-time marketing team means you can control the automation process better and focus on your business goals more clearly. This is perfect for the companies having complex and long-term marketing strategies that demand continuous scaling.

In-house marketing teams are a better choice for large businesses that have a good budget and resources to support a team. It is ideal for those who are seeking long-term progress and automation success.

Final Words

If you want to choose between marketing automation consultant vs In-house team then it totally depends on your budget and goals.

A consultant is ideal if you want quick results or professional help without long-term commitment. But if your target is to achieve long-term results and ongoing automation then building an In-house team is best because it gives you more control and long-term support.

First, look at your current needs and future goals then decide which option is more suitable for your business to achieve targets.

Buy on Envato

Kickstart your project with our expert assistance.

Get In Touch
+44(0)20 3156
+1 866 512 0268

Get your project underway.